Position Summary

To independently perform and report laboratory findings in accordance with policies and procedures of The Department of Pathology and Laboratory Medicine, FDA, CAP, AABB, OSHA, CLIA, and JCAHO regulations to facilitate quality patient care.

Education

Bachelor's degree and certification at the Medical Technologist level (ASCP, AMT, or Equivalent) or Bachelor's degree and categorical certification consistent with the work performed: C, H, I, BB, M (ASCP).

Experience

1 year clinical laboratory experience.

Skills

A Registered Medical Laboratory Technologist demonstrates comprehensive knowledge of clinical laboratory principles, testing methodologies, instrumentation, quality assurance, and regulatory requirements. Possesses strong analytical,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ills with the ability to perform and evaluate complex laboratory testing accurately and efficiently. Proficient in laboratory information systems and standard computer applications, with excellent organizational, communication, and time management skills. Able to prioritize workload, work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ment, troubleshoot technical issues, maintain quality and patient safety standards, and provide training and guidance to students and new staff while demonstrating professionalism, accountability, and sound judgment
